Feedback welcome - SFO to Australia on J
 
Hi all,

Would like to hear any feedback or tips for my award redemption. Booked one way from SFO -> HKG -> MEL for 85k Cathay Pacific points plus $400 in taxes in business.

UA in J was ~200k one way.
Aeroplan via YVR was similar.
Qantas was 1 million points lmao.

I have 500k MR, 500k UR, and 200K AS points.

Would love to hear any feedback or tips on how I could/ could have improved this. Thanks!
